 The International Conference organized by the (Amesea) & October 6 University will discuss the encounter of civilizations in the context of globalization as a contemporary input to deal with the problems of globalization and how digital technologies have contributed to the way and the roles of artist and artwork, management, educational and Art  institutions and cultural institutions. To achieve a balance between the advantages of interactive integration and protect the unique character of the local culture that requires a rational approach. It  will also addresses the development of culture to  be the core of development policies, rather than be limited to the rigid repair and conservation efforts, but on the contrary, investing in the potential of local resources, knowledge, skills and ways of promoting creativity and the efforts of sustainable progress. Hence, it is worth mentioning that the respect for the diversity of cultures create conditions for mutual understanding and benefit from the diversity of creativity and then dialogue and peace.

The purpose of the "Conference" is to find the starting points of the intellectual arts practices through  the encounter of civilizations rather than a clash of civilizations, and the opening of a multi-disciplinary conversation to discuss the role of the arts in society. Of providing a place to participate actively and testing and experimentation of the ideas and concepts of Arts and global contexts, on stage, in studios and theaters, in the classroom, in museums and galleries, in the streets and in local communities.

The International Society for Education through Art (InSEA) was founded in the wake of World War II in the twentieth century, where the Society is established on a global basis to target those concerned with education through art to be able to exchange experiences and improve practices and promote Art position in all levels of education, the Society also strengthen international cooperation and understanding between peoples and human right to participate freely in cultural life in the community and to enjoy the arts .
